hey people, my wife just got a letter monday dated back to April 22nd asking for additional documents to be submitted in 90 days, if she fails to do this then they could even refuse to put the visa on her passport. These are the documents requested:
- More proofs of relationship, in particular of comunication, since the beginning of the relationship (phone bills, letters, emails, cards, receipts of money send, property/vehicle/insurance/bank account in common, trips together, receipts of money send, photos together, etc).
- Copies of sponsor’s passport page showing all entry and exits stamps since 2001.
- Copy of your “certificat de selection du quebec”
- Original marriage certificate (“extracto de acta de matrimonio”)
- Original birth certificate (“extracto de acta de nacimiento”
I already sent her today the documents I needed to send via federal express, she will be getting them friday. I had to send the copies of the passport which were submitted when I started the process... I sent more pictures, letters, Fido phone bills (she is getting some bills from her phone number too with the received calls), emails, phone cards linked to my cellphone bills, selection certificate, etc.... and she will be sending some letters she has from me too and some emails she wrote me and some other pics she has there of us and some more stuff.
Well this is kinda like a relief since I can see they are indeed working on my file and will continue next week when my wife goes to santo domingo to send all the documents to haiti via Fedex so we can get a tracking code and see when they receive the docs. The person who is helping me told me that they are probably asking for these documents so that they can call her in some weeks to ask for the passport and put the visa, but I think it could be possibly for an interview too and my wife is getting ready for the interview as well just in case....well she doesnt need to get ready that much for it because we have been together since a long time (16/02/2003) and things are going great....and will get even better when she finally arrives here....

Hi caredbl84, My wife dropped off dropped off her police certificate at the Embassy in Santo Domingo, and Haiti got it with no problems. I know the feeling of uncertainty though, because they do not give anything saying you gave it to them. Most of the time when they requested documents from us, I had my wife Fedex it to me, so I can just confirm all documents were in order. Then I used Purolator with signature to send it to Haiti. Never had any problems. I'm sure if your wife takes both your documents to the Santo Domingo Embassy they will send it to Haiti, The woman will even tell you when Haiti will receive it, I would just mark every page with your case/file number, and follow up with an email after a week or so to make sure everything was received. They got back to me with no problems.

Carlos,
when we tracked our package with UPS and saw that it was delivered the website listed the name of the person that signed for the package. I copied that page into a word document and then had my husband send a message via the Haiti website indicating that he had sent the requested documents via UPS and uploaded the word document showing that it had been delivered and who signed for it.
